oh absolutely -- part of the point of a modular synth is you can mix and match parts and put me wherever in the cabinet so you can have three oscillators or two lfos or filters what have you apparently hans zimmer had one, here's the load out >3 VCO. 1 factory custom with waveform select ,from a single output >1 VCF. Freq AND resonnance are volt. controlled. >1 HPF with resonnance. Freq AND resonnance are volt. controlled. >4 VCA ( 2 dual) >4 DADSR (2 dual) : 1 standard dual, 1 dual factory custom :the upper with 2 gate selector , the lower with 2 outputs selector and attenuator. >5 mixers .each with 4 ins and + - outputs. >1 LFO. 5 waveforms, control over PW and freq. >1 rare quadrature oscillator. 4 outs, for surround panning or other complex modulations. >1 octave divider. for waveforms or impulses. >1 dual Sample and Hold. >1 dual ring modulation. >1 (spring) reverb. >1 enveloppe folower. >1 phase shifter. >1 voltage quantizer >3 multiples . >1 5 bands Parametric EQ. 5 X frequency / Q /Level.+cut / boost. >1 bipolar attenuators. X 3. >1 variableDC source. X 3. >1 keyboard output controller, with pressure, dynamics, X/Y controls >corresponding to the polyfusion keyboards wide possibilities,or to be connected to a Kenton >2 power supplies.
